Cooking / Assembly Process
A technical discussion of heat management, visual and tactile doneness cues, and equipment considerations for the air fryer environment, without listing the specific cooking steps. Cooking in a compact convection environment relies on rapid air movement and concentrated surface heat; this accelerates surface drying and encourages browning while minimizing interior overcooking when managed carefully. Use a basket or tray with adequate perforation and avoid overcrowding to allow airflow to circulate evenly. Observe the transformation: the perimeter will become matte and then take on a pale gold patina; the center will transition from glossy to a subtly drier, set appearance. Tactile cues are essential—when gently pressed at the center, properly cooked pieces will yield slightly and then recover, indicating retained moisture; if the center feels viscous or overly soft, allow additional brief thermal exposure or a short resting period outside the hot environment to permit carryover setting. Consider rotating the basket half-way through the thermal cycle if your unit has known hot spots to ensure uniform coloration. If a deeper caramelization is desired, a brief increase in temperature for a very short interval will intensify surface browning, but exercise caution: excessive heat will produce a brittle, overly dry interior. For delicate edge crispness, remove the pieces to rack and allow ambient airflow to finish the drying process; the outer crust will firm as the internal temperature equilibrates. The cookware should be shallow and elegant—avoid dark nonstick surfaces that accelerate browning unpredictably. These principles will produce consistent results in varied convection units without relying on rigid timing.

Storage & Make-Ahead Tips
Practical guidance for preserving texture and freshness, including short-term storage, freezing, and revival techniques tailored to the cookie's moist interior and crisp exterior. The central challenge in storage is maintaining contrast between a crisp exterior and a tender interior. For short-term storage of up to two days, keep the pieces at room temperature in a single layer separated by parchment to prevent sticking; use a shallow, rigid container to avoid crushing and limit humidity exposure. For preservation beyond a few days, freezing is the preferred method: flash-freeze in a single layer before transferring to an airtight container to prevent surface abrasion and loss of crispness. When thawing frozen pieces, do so at room temperature and then refresh briefly in a gentle convection environment to restore edge crispness without drying the interior. Avoid microwaving for revival, as rapid, uneven heating will produce a rubbery texture and accelerate moisture loss. If the stored items have softened, a brief and monitored low-temperature blast in the convection unit will reestablish the desired textural contrast by driving off superficial moisture and re-crisping the crust while leaving the interior tender. For make-ahead assembly, prepare the mixed mass and portion into rounds on parchment, then freeze the unbaked portions; bake from frozen with a slight increase in exposure time and close observation for color development. Proper container selection, controlled thawing, and brief reheating are the keys to maintaining original sensory qualities over time.
Frequently Asked Questions
A focused FAQ that anticipates common technical and flavor concerns and offers precise, technique-driven answers without repeating recipe specifics.
- How can I adjust chew versus crispness? Manipulate hydration and thermal exposure: greater initial hydration and shorter cooking times favor chew; reduced hydration and slightly longer or hotter exposure favor crispness. A short resting period after mixing allows full hydration and improves interior tenderness.
- My cookies spread too much—what causes this? Excess free moisture or over-activation of soluble starches can increase spread. Ensure gentle mixing and avoid adding additional liquid. Portioning into compact shapes rather than very flat rounds reduces unwanted lateral movement.
- How do I prevent an overly dry interior? Monitor doneness by tactile cues: the center should feel set but not rock-hard when touched. If necessary, reduce thermal exposure in small increments and allow residual carryover to complete setting.
- Can I substitute with other grains or fruit purées? Yes, but expect changes in texture and moisture balance. Coarser flake sizes will increase tooth and may require longer hydration; denser purées will reduce spread and increase moistness.
Low-Calorie Air Fryer Oatmeal Cookies
Craving a guilt-free treat? Try these low-calorie air fryer oatmeal cookies—crispy outside, chewy inside!
total time
20
servings
12
calories
80 kcal
ingredients
- Rolled oats — 1 cup (90 g) 🥣
- Mashed ripe banana — 1 medium (about 120 g) 🍌
- Unsweetened applesauce — 2 tbsp (30 g) 🍏
- Egg white — 1 large 🥚
- Ground cinnamon — 1 tsp (2 g) 🌿
- Baking powder — 1/2 tsp 🧂
- Vanilla extract — 1 tsp (5 ml) 🌼
- Pinch of salt — 1/8 tsp 🧂
- Raisins (optional) — 2 tbsp (20 g) 🍇
instructions
- Preheat the air fryer to 160°C (320°F).
- In a bowl, mash the ripe banana and mix with applesauce, egg white and vanilla until smooth.
- Add rolled oats, cinnamon, baking powder and salt; stir until combined and slightly sticky.
- Fold in raisins if using.
- Scoop tablespoon-sized portions onto a sheet of parchment and flatten slightly to cookie shape.
- Place cookies in a single layer in the air fryer basket (do not overcrowd).
- Air fry at 160°C for 8–10 minutes until edges are golden and centers set.
- Let cookies cool 5 minutes on a rack to firm up before serving.
